Check 3rd Party Lab Results

Sometimes buying from the biggest names in the industry isn’t enough. Sometimes, we want to be convinced that we’re buying the right product. One way to do this is by checking the lab results for each product. Every CBD seller must provide customers with results from third-party laboratories that determine the quality of the CBD used in the product.

These results are provided by the company that makes the product and is given to the sellers. If you’re not sure whether or not the product is quality enough, then make sure to ask them for lab results.

When buying online, the lab results are usually displayed with each product. Also, CBD sellers in Canada should make it a priority to have the lab results easily accessible to customers.

Find Out What the Product Contains

CBD products naturally contain cannabidiol. But that’s not the only ingredient. In CBD oil, for example, the product has to contain some sort of carrier oil to preserve the CBD. In many cases, although not exclusive, this is MCT oil. Other types of carrier oil include hemp seed oil, olive oil, and avocado oil, among others.

Although all of these work well, you should at least know the carrier oil used in the making of the product. Different carrier oils are also quite different in how efficient they are. Consider the Type of CBD

CBD products can be made from Full Spectrum, Broad Spectrum, or CBD Isolate. For more information on this, CFAH.org is a great resource.

While no doubt some of these buzz words will confuse you, everything will be made clear once we expand on them.

When it comes to the many compounds of the hemp plant, CBD takes center stage. While other compounds, cannabinoids, and terpenes exist, cannabidiol is the most numerical. But what about the others? Well, no doubt some of you are familiar with yet another compound of the hemp plant called THC.

Canadians are most familiar with THC from the marijuana plant. Hemp also contains THC, but much less of it. And if you want your CBD oil to contain all the compounds, cannabinoids, and terpenes of the hemp plant, then you should go for Full Spectrum products. When it comes to the THC content in Full Spectrum CBD, the products cannot contain more than 0.3% of THC.

This is probably the biggest lure of Full Spectrum CBD. But with all that said, many Canadians prefer products without THC. If that’s something you’re looking for, then you can opt for Broad Spectrum or CBD Isolate.

Broad Spectrum is very similar to Full Spectrum, with the only noticeable difference being that Broad Spectrum doesn’t contain THC. CBD Isolate, on the other hand, is a completely different story. While we won’t get into how CBD products are made or how we extract cannabidiol from the hemp plant in this section, it’s important to understand that CBD Isolate contains only cannabidiol.

With CBD Isolate, Canadians are getting close to 99.9% pure CBD extract. Truthfully speaking, cannabidiol is the only ingredient. At the end of the extraction process, we’re left with pure CBD in crystalline or powdery form.

Where Was the Hemp Grown and Manufactured?

Canadian hemp farms are the biggest source of CBD. Whenever out shopping for CBD oil or any other product, you must find out where and how the hemp was grown and manufactured.

These two are very important as the soil can have a significant impact on the overall quality of the final product. If the soil contains metals and harmful toxins, then we won’t be able to derive quality cannabidiol.

Luckily for us, CBD is heavily regulated in Canada and hemp farmers must abide by certain regulations in terms of soil texture.

The same can be said about manufacturing CBD. Once Canadian hemp farmers harvest the plant, the next step is to extract the CBD. A couple of extraction processes exist, of which the only one that matters is the CO2 method.

Other methods, such as solvent and steam distillation aren’t up to standards and can be very harmful. The CO2 extraction method is by far the most superior as it is the safest, cleanest, and most versatile method of extracting CBD from hemp.
